USAID/SIDA Fostering Interventions for Rapid Market Advancement (FIRMA) in Bosnia and Herzegovina (BiH)
The objective of FIRMA is to generate sustained economic growth measured as increases in sales and employment and improved capacity of private enterprises to withstand competitive pressures emanating from a globalized economy.
The purpose of FIRMA project is to increase sustainable economic growth and employment in three sectors (wood processing, tourism, and light manufacturing/metal processing) by enhancing the competitiveness of the BiH small and medium size enterprises (SMEs).
FIRMA provides targeted, demand-driven assistance to SMEs in targeted sectors in addressing critical constraints for growth such as: poor quality/ design of products; inadequate marketing and links to global markets; limited supply of skilled labor and limited access to finance.Also, FIRMA will provide assistance in addressing policy constraints for growth of private enterprises in targeted sectors.
